Dewey, Admiral Ge<strong>org</strong>e. 92 D5i4de<br />

Autobiography of Ge<strong>org</strong>e Dewey, admiral of the navy. 1913. Scribner.<br />

"Gives with conciseness, and yet in a style that proves highly readable, the main<br />

facts of his ancestry, education, naval experience under Farragut at New Orleans and<br />

his later service in the Civil War...his appointment to the command of the Asiatic<br />

squadron, the battle of Manila Bay and the complex responsibilities imposed upon the<br />

victor immediately thereafter, and the chief events of his later peaceful years. . -Pictures<br />

of war vessels and portraits of their officers abound." Dial, 1913.<br />

Diirer, Albrecht. 92 Dg4id<br />

Records of journeys to Venice and the Low countries; ed. by Roger<br />

Fry. 1913. Merrymount Press. (Humanist's library.)<br />

A familiar view of the great artist is revealed in these unpretentious letters in<br />

which he writes freely, not of art but of such prosaic details as the sale of his pictures,<br />

his traveling expenses, meetings with fellow craftsmen and patrons, and other incidents<br />

of travel.<br />

Eliot, Ge<strong>org</strong>e, (pseud, of Mrs Mary Ann (Evans) Cross). g2 E476d<br />

Deakin, Mary H. The early life of Ge<strong>org</strong>e Eliot. 1913. Manchester<br />

University Press. (Manchester University. English series, 110.4.)<br />

"Covers the first forty years of her life and indicates, at the same time, the very<br />

few events of any importance which occurred later... Miss Deakin is guided by an exceptionally<br />

sympathetic insight into her author's spiritual life... She is inclined [at<br />

times] to over-estimate Ge<strong>org</strong>e Eliot's art... But on the whole she avoids the critical<br />

standpoint and keeps to her aim of dealing with the novelist's works only in so far as<br />

they illuminate her personality." Dial, 1913.<br />

Kellogg, Clara Louise. 92 Ki68k<br />

Memoirs of an American prima donna. 1913. Putnam.<br />

Miss Kellogg, afterward Mme Strakosch, gives varied and intimate experiences in<br />

these recollections, which cover about 25 years, beginning with her first appearance in<br />

1861.
